Erstellen einer Web-App (einer App Service-App)
https://portal.azure.com/#home
Bedienbereiche bei Azure Portal
Dann erstellt man eine Resource mit ->Ressource erstellen
https://portal.azure.com/#create/hub
Dann gibt man im Suche-Feld Web-App ein und wählt die Web-App aus
https://portal.azure.com/#create/hub
https://portal.azure.com/#create/hub
Mit App Service-Web-Apps können Sie schnell für jede beliebige Plattform Web-, Mobil- und API-Apps der Unternehmensklasse erstellen, bereitstellen und skalieren
Mich interessieren hier:
Dann endet meistens der "Learning" teil
Sie sind aktuell beim Verzeichnis "Microsoft Learn Sandbox" angemeldet, das keine Abonnements umfasst. Sie können entweder zu einem anderen Verzeichnis wechseln oder sich für ein neues Abonnement registrieren.
Keine Abonnements im Verzeichnis "Microsoft Learn Sandbox". Wechseln Sie zu einem anderen Verzeichnis.
Dann kommt man eventuell nur weiter, wenn man ein kostenpflichtiges Abonnement eingetragen hat, oder anders gesagt: wenn man die Credit-Karte angeben hat.
Nur weiter mit Registrierung und Credit-Karte
Anschliessend muss man sich mit einer Credit-Karte registrieren. (typisch Microsoft und vorspielen von "Tutorial") Abzocke
https://portal.azure.com/?quickstart=True#blade/Microsoft_Azure_Resources/QuickstartCenterBlade
Web-App erstellen
!! Bitte hier auf die KOSTEN achten… Microsoft bucht knallhart ab
Im Abonnement : muss man einen Account einstellen, welcher bezahlt. Entweder der Firmenaccount oder ein privater Account mit Mastercard (vorsicht Kostenfalle)
Unter Ressourcengruppe:
Betriebssystem: Windows
EXTREM WICHTIG: HIER auf GRÖSSE Ändern klicken
und eine kostenlose oder günstige Option auswählen.
Microsoft schlägt im Standard gleich mal 56 Euro pro Monat drauf
Einstellungen bie SKU und Größe:
Spezifikationsauswahl-> auf Dev/Test wechseln
WICHTIG: AUF Dev/Test wechseln für Entwicklungsumgebungen
F1Freigegebene Infrastruktur 1 GB Arbeitsspeicher 60 Minuten/Tag für Computeressourcen Frei
|
D1Freigegebene Infrastruktur 1 GB Arbeitsspeicher 240 Minuten/Tag für Computeressourcen 8.00 EUR/Monat (geschätzt)
|
Bereitstellung (Vorschau)
GitHub Actions
GitHub Actions ist ein Automatisierungsframework, in dem Ihre App erstellt, getestet und bereitgestellt werden kann, sobald in Ihrem Repository ein neuer Commit ausgeführt wird. Wenn sich Ihr Code in GitHub befindet, wählen Sie hier Ihr Repository aus. Wir fügen dann eine Workflowdatei hinzu, um Ihre App automatisch in App Service bereitzustellen.
Wenn Ihr Code nicht in GitHub enthalten ist, wechseln Sie nach dem Erstellen der Web-App zum Bereitstellungscenter,
CD Continuous Deployment
Beim Aktivieren von CD muss man den Zugriff auf GitHub einstellen
Azure App Überwachung, Insights
Azure Monitor Application Insights ist ein APM-Dienst (Application Performance Management) für Entwickler und DevOps-Experten. Aktivieren Sie diese Option, um Ihre Anwendung automatisch zu überwachen. Die Funktionalität erkennt Leistungsanomalien und umfasst leistungsstarke Tools für die Analyse, mit denen Sie Probleme diagnostizieren können und Informationen zur Nutzung Ihrer App durch die Benutzer erhalten
Tags
Tags sind Name/Wert-Paare, die Ihnen das Kategorisieren von Ressourcen und die Anzeige einer konsolidierten Abrechnung ermöglichen, indem Sie dasselbe Tag auf mehrere Ressourcen und Ressourcengruppen anwenden.
Hinweis: Wenn Sie Tags erstellen und anschließend die Ressourceneinstellungen auf anderen Registerkarten ändern, werden Ihre Tags automatisch aktualisiert.
Zusammenfassung Web-App
Zusammenfassung
Web-App
von Microsoft
SKU "Free"
Geschätzter Preis - Wird geladen...
Details
Abonnement Ressourcengruppe
Codedocu Name
Codedocu Veröffentlichen
Code Runtimestapel
.NET 5 Tags
CodeDocu: WebApp
App Service-Plan (neu)
Name ASP-codedocu-a8f6
Betriebssystem Windows
Region West Europe
SKU Free
ACU Freigegebene Infrastruktur
Speicher 1 GB Arbeitsspeicher
Tags CodeDocu: WebApp
Überwachung (neu)
Application Insights Aktiviert
Name codedocu
Region West Europe
Tags CodeDocu: WebApp
Bereitstellung (Vorschau)
Continuous Deployment
Nach der App-Erstellung nicht aktiviert/eingerichtet
Nach Abschluss: